Whitchurch station is equipped with essential amenities to facilitate a smooth journey. Although there is no ticket office, you’ll find a ticket machine where you can collect tickets bought online using a major debit or credit card. For those requiring assistance, there are help points available, and information screens provide details of departure and arrival times.
Accessibility is a key feature at the station with step-free access available on Platform 2, which services routes to Crewe. For traveling to Shrewsbury on Platform 1, note that access is via a footbridge with 44 steps. Passenger assist services are available with requests being required at least two hours before departure.
The station has 31 parking spaces available 24/7, along with dedicated accessible parking spots. Though lacking in refreshment shops and waiting lounges, the station still maintains a friendly environment with seating areas present.
When it comes to continuing your journey from Whitchurch, you’ll find convenient transport links right by the station. A rail replacement bus service operates, collecting passengers from nearby Station Road. Although there are no bicycle hire facilities, cycling enthusiasts can make use of the six bicycle stands available on the Crewe-bound platform. While taxis and car hire services aren't specified at the station, local options within Whitchurch are readily available for hire if needed.

Bexleyheath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for a smooth and accessible travel experience.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day until 20:00 and slightly reduced hours on Sunday. For those collecting tickets bought online, accessible machines are available in the station forecourt. The station embraces modern ticketing with smartcards issued and validated here.
The station boasts full step-free access, making it easy for those with mobility needs to navigate. Although there are 83 parking spaces available, including four accessible ones, bear in mind that parking equipment here isn't fully adapted for accessibility needs. While the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, other conveniences like payphones, a coffee kiosk, and a newspaper stand are present. Secure storage for 32 bicycles is available, though hiring services are not a facility at this station. Remember, CCTV offers peace of mind in various areas, ensuring safety during your visit.
For onward travel, Bexleyheath Station efficiently connects you with local bus services and rail replacement options. If a journey toward Lewisham or Dartford is in your plans, make use of bus stops BF and BH respectively on Pickford Lane. Planning ahead is simplified with further information available in printable formats online, allowing you to coordinate public transport options smoothly.
Bexleyheath Station opens a myriad of travel possibilities with regular services to prominent locations. The journey to central London is a breeze with routes to London Bridge, Cannon Street, and Charing Cross. For those heading to the cultural hub of London Victoria, or exploring Greenwich via Lewisham, these routes are regular and convenient, catering to both regular commuters and the adventurous at heart. Other destinations like Farringdon, Denmark Hill, or Dartford promise straightforward connectivity.
